The logo that was booed down in 1979 was actually more of a swirling "P"

I wish I could find an image of that logo, but I do remember when it was displayed for fans. There was actually a live "vote" at halftime of a game. They displayed the logo current at the time "pat patriot" and the new logo and asked fans to vote with applause for the one they wanted. Pat Patriot won in a landslide. In fact, the new logo was booed loudly. Pat Patriot then stayed as the logo until Elvis came along......
